Can anyone hear my baby monitor?

May 20th, 2008 | By Webmaster | Category: Articles

A baby monitor is essentially a radio transmitter on a fixed frequency that transmits a FM signal.

baby monitor

Baby monitors transmit in the 48-50 MHz range. Common baby monitor channels:

  • 49.300
  • 49.830
  • 49.845
  • 49.862.50
  • 49.845
